Documents commonly prepared for Antigua and Barbuda
- Birth, marriage, death, and divorce records
- FBI background checks and police clearances
- Diplomas, transcripts, and school records
- Powers of attorney, affidavits, and consent letters
- Business records, certificates of good standing, and corporate documents
Before you mail documents
Confirm the receiving agency's instructions for Antigua and Barbuda, the exact document type, whether translations are required, and whether the document must be issued recently. A quick review can prevent apostille or legalization rejection.
